Output 6bbafe20921fc72da39bc604dbedfc93006928256d8894ddb9b691cde574e86e:0

value
630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f6a7617da33c277d4621800e38d98197ceaee94 OP_EQUAL
address
3DJjGy3egkSbQEWHUiSUeceCMT3z4YurvB
transaction
6bbafe20921fc72da39bc604dbedfc93006928256d8894ddb9b691cde574e86e
spent
true